can dogs eat marmalade: Safe or Not?

No, dogs should not eat marmalade. Marmalade is often high in sugar and can cause digestive upset, obesity, and tooth decay in dogs. Additionally, some marmalades contain xylitol, a sweetener that is toxic to dogs. It is best to avoid giving marmalade or any other sugary foods to your dog.

While small amounts of marmalade may not necessarily harm your dog, it is not recommended to feed it to them for several reasons:

1. High Sugar Content: Marmalade is typically high in sugar, which can lead to obesity, dental issues, and other health problems in dogs.

2. Artificial Ingredients: Many commercially-made marmalades contain artificial colors, flavors, and preservatives that can be harmful to dogs.

3. Potential Toxicity: Some marmalades may contain ingredients that are toxic to dogs, such as xylitol, which is a sweetener that can be toxic to dogs in even small amounts.

4. Digestive Issues: Dogs may have trouble digesting the high sugar and potentially other ingredients in marmalade, leading to gastrointestinal upset.

Overall, it is best to avoid feeding marmalade to your dog and stick to feeding them a balanced diet of dog-friendly foods to keep them healthy and happy.
